Push-ups, the quintessential bodyweight exercise, not only sculpt your arms and chest but also ignite a calorie-burning furnace within your body. With each rep, your muscles contract, fueling your metabolic rate and torching calories. The number consumed depends on factors like your weight, intensity, and fitness level. On average, a 155-pound person can expect to incinerate around 4 calories per minute of vigorous push-ups. Incorporate variations like diamond or decline push-ups to challenge different muscle groups and amplify the inferno.
